Culinary Institute of America General Information

Culinary Institute of America is a private not-for-profit, 4-year or above school located in Hyde Park, New York. There may be one or more Culinary Institute of America private student loan programs available.

Federal Aid
Eligible students may receive Pell Grants and other federal aid (e.g. Stafford Loan) or scholarships. Students will not be eligible for federal aid without completing the FAFSA. Here is a link to the Culinary Institute of America FAFSA School Code.
